A Postgraduate Certificate in Surface Profiling provides specialized training in advanced surface metrology techniques. Students gain practical skills in analyzing surface textures and their impact on various applications.
The program's learning outcomes include mastering data acquisition using different surface profiling instruments, such as atomic force microscopes (AFM) and optical profilometers. Students will also develop proficiency in interpreting surface roughness parameters, understanding the principles of 3D surface reconstruction, and applying this knowledge to solve real-world engineering challenges.
Typically, the duration of a Postgraduate Certificate in Surface Profiling is between 6 months and a year, depending on the institution and course intensity. Some programs offer part-time options for working professionals.
